Verizon Wholesale Markets Re-Named Verizon Partner Solutions as Wholesale Efforts of Verizon and Former MCI Are Combined


WEBWIRE

Newly Integrated Team Will Focus on Domestic Wholesale Market, Utilizing Advanced Networking Capabilities and Skilled Teams to Offer Full-Service Networking Solutions and 24x7 Customer Support

March 20, 2006, NEW YORK - The new Verizon Partner Solutions organization - comprised of the former wholesale team at Verizon and the domestic wholesale team at the former MCI - has launched an aggressive effort to expand its presence throughout the United States.

Utilizing one of the most advanced telecom networks in the world, the Verizon Partner Solutions team is focused on selling networks and network capabilities to telecom service providers that include: long-distance providers, local service providers, wireless carriers, cable companies, integrators, Internet service providers (ISPs) and international telecommunications carriers that are based in the U.S.

“As we accelerate our efforts in what is a very competitive market, our goal is to be a full-service provider that offers a complete array of global telecom solutions to help our customers serve their end-users,” said David Small, president of Verizon Partner Solutions. “Among our primary strategies are the constant development of online tools to facilitate ordering; the availability of IP-based solutions into the Verizon Partner Solutions portfolio of wholesale solutions; and continuing to enhance our optical and ethernet services to meet our growing customer needs.”

Today, Verizon Partner Solutions serves more than 3,000 customers at locations throughout the country. The organization has about 8,400 employees.

This year, Verizon Partner Solutions will focus on offering customers advanced products and services based on three specific technologies:

* Optical networking - including the following services: Optical Hubbing Service, Dedicated SONET Rings and Intellilight Optical Transport Service (a wave division optical technology service)

* Internet Protocol (IP) Technology - including: Carrier IP Termination and SIP Gateway Service

* Ethernet - including : Verizon Optical Networking, Transparent LAN Service and LAN Extension Service

“The integration of the former MCI domestic services and their IP-based network gives us a much more expansive and robust portfolio of advanced services for our customers,” said Quintin Lew, vice president of access of Verizon Partner Solutions.

As a single face to the domestic U.S. wholesale market, Verizon Partner Solutions will work with other Verizon groups, including the new Verizon Business team, to design and implement tailored solutions to best meet wholesale customers’ needs.

Verizon Communications Inc. (NYSE:VZ), a Dow 30 company, is a leader in delivering broadband and other communication innovations to wireline and wireless customers. Verizon operates America’s most reliable wireless network, serving 51.3 million customers nationwide; one of the most expansive wholly-owned global IP networks; and one of the nation’s premier wireline networks, serving home, business and wholesale customers. Based in New York, Verizon has a diverse workforce of approximately 250,000 and generates annual consolidated operating revenues of approximately $90 billion.
